(a) Except as otherwise provided by this section, to be appointed
to serve as a steward, an individual must:
(1) have appropriate experience, as provided by subsection
(b) of this section;
(2) satisfactorily pass an optical examination conducted annually,
indicating at least 20/20 vision, corrected, and the ability to distinguish
colors;
(3) agree to a complete background check to ensure the individual's
integrity is above reproach;
(4) satisfactorily pass a written examination prescribed by
the executive secretary; and
(5) demonstrate to the executive secretary's satisfaction that
the individual's income from sources other than as a steward is unrelated
to patronage of or employment by a licensee of the Commission.
(b) To be appointed to serve as a steward, an individual must:
(1) have served as an official at a race meeting recognized
by the Commission or another racing jurisdiction; or
(2) demonstrate to the satisfaction of the executive secretary
that the individual has sufficient experience in a racing-related field to
perform the duties of a steward.
(c) The executive secretary shall administer the written examination
for stewards. A passing grade for the written examination is 85%.
